Need public to help solving drug trafficking cases: CM

BICHOLIM

Chief Minister Pramod Sawant said there is a need to reduce Goa’s crime rate for which there is a need to provide better facilities to the police personnel. He was addressing a gathering after inaugurating the newly renovated police outpost building at Sakhali on Saturday. The function was also attended by deputy chief minister Babu Kavlekar, Sakhali Municipal 

Council (SMC) chairperson Dharmesh Saglani, police officials, councilors, panch, sarpanch and large number of gathering.  

Talking about the drugs abuse in Goa, Sawant said that drugs have reached everywhere in Goa not only in villages and hence the role of people helping police to arrest people involved in drug trafficking is pivotal.

He said it is the duty of parents to keep a watch over their children so that they don’t become drug victims. He also said that everybody is talking about drug abuse on a massive scale but nobody comes forward to help the police.
